Key Program Features
- Duration: 14 months
- Language of instruction: English
- Study mode: On-campus
- English requirement: IELTS 6.5
- Tuition: EUR 13,500 (Tuition (Year)) — International students; EUR 12,000 (Tuition (Year)) — EU/EEA students
- Location: Athens, Greece

Admission Requirements
Academic Requirements
You need the following GMAT score:
The average GMAT score from last intake (fall 2016) was 660.
The GMAT is specifically designed for admission to business or management schools, and is meant to test how prepared you are for a business degree programme
Admission requirements
All candidates must have a solid academic background demonstrated by a university degree from a formally recognized Greek or foreign University. Variety in the profile of the candidates is encouraged. Applicants must also possess strong command of both spoken and written English. In addition, all candidates for the Full-time program must submit their scores of the GMAT test. The short teaching periods and the intense schedule require close attendance and special devotion of all students.
To be considered for a place in the program, candidates must also demonstrate (through the application form, the essays, the recommendation letters and the compulsory interview) that they possess the essential qualities and motivation required from tomorrows international managers and business leaders.
English Proficiency: IELTS 6.5 or equivalent.
